Dirt Structure and Wellness


Healthy and balanced dirt is the structure of a productive landscape. It is important to assess dirt make-up to comprehend its nutrition content, pH degrees, and organic matter. Conducting a dirt test can reveal these variables, permitting targeted modifications.



  • Change with Raw Material: Integrate compost, aged manure, or environment-friendly manure to boost soil framework and nutrient accessibility. This enhances microbial task, which is important for nutrient biking.


  • Adjust pH Degrees: Utilize lime to increase pH or sulfur to lower it, relying on the needs of certain plants. Most plants prosper in a pH variety of 6.0 to 7.0.


  • Take Care Of Soil Erosion: Apply contour horticulture, terracing, or growing cover crops during off-seasons to stop erosion and improve dirt security.



Water Management Approaches


Effective water administration is essential for sustaining a dynamic landscape. Proper irrigation techniques lessen waste and advertise healthy plant growth.



  • Drip Irrigation: This system provides water straight to the plant origins, reducing evaporation and runoff. It is especially valuable in deserts.


  • Rain Harvesting: Install rain barrels to collect runoff from roofing systems. This supplies an environmentally friendly water resource for yard irrigation.


  • Mulching for Wetness Retention: Use organic mulch, such as straw or wood chips, around plants to minimize dissipation. Mulch likewise subdues weeds, additionally saving water and preserving soil health.

Bring In Pollinators and Beneficial Insects


To foster an atmosphere for pollinators and beneficial bugs, integrate a range of blooming plants. Native flowers, such as Echinacea and Rudbeckia, not only prosper yet additionally offer nectar and pollen.


Producing varied environments can likewise consist of:



  • Various blossom durations: Select varieties that grow in springtime, summer season, and fall.

  • Layered growings: Usage different elevations to create shelter and range.

  • Preventing chemicals: Chemical therapies can damage beneficial pests.


Providing a water resource, like a tiny birdbath or superficial meal, likewise draws in pollinators. These techniques enhance community health and plant reproduction.


Structure Functions for Birds and Little Mammals


Designing environments for birds and tiny animals calls for specific frameworks. Birdhouses, feeders, and baths can draw species such as bluebirds and wrens. When selecting birdhouses, take into consideration:



  • Measurements: Match the entrance opening size to the desired varieties.

  • Materials: Usage all-natural woods without chemical therapies.

  • Placement: Setting houses in protected areas, secure from predators.


For small animals, offering brush heaps and native hedges can produce safety cover. Planting berry-producing hedges helps receive regional wild animals by providing food resources throughout the year.

Lasting Insect Control


Carrying out lasting bug control strategies helps keep the environmental equilibrium. Integrated Parasite Management (IPM) is an essential strategy. This entails tracking parasite populaces and using a mix of biological, social, and mechanical controls.


Biological controls may include introducing beneficial bugs, while cultural practices might involve turning crops to disrupt pest life process. Mechanical techniques, such as obstacles and catches, minimize bug populaces without chemicals.


Limit chemical usage, opting for natural services just when needed. Regular surveillance assists identify any kind of emerging hazards and addresses them immediately.
